San Andreas doesn't work really good works really bad with the Xbox360pad.
  • The right stick and the triggers doesn't work. :roll:
    The left stick is for movement, but the Dpad is too. :?:
    The original button mapping is garbage. :leftthumbdown:
But it isn't also really possible to disable the native controller support to use Xpadder without any disruptions, so you first have to prepare the game to use it's native controller support together with Xpadder.


First possibility:
1. Open the folder "GTA San Andreas User Files" (you'll find it in your Documents folder) and rename the file "gta_sa.set" to something like "gta_saold.set" (it doesn't really matter, but make sure that you can restore the original file name if needed).
2. Download my settings file and place it in your "GTA San Andreas User Files" folder.
3. After loading the the profile (on the lower end of this post) and starting the game you have to configure two setting under Options->Display Settings->Advanced, the entries "Resolution" and "Widescreen". The other settings are simply on maximum, if your PC isn't almost antique this should be OK.
It would also be a good idea to have a look on the language setting, if your preferred language isn't English.
  • Note: If the game doesn't start anymore with my file, the reason should be that only works with Windows7. Since my WindowsXP settings file also caused this problem under Windows7 I formally expect that. :?
    In this case delete my settings file, rename back your original file and start with the second more ornate possibility.

Second possibility:
Configure the control setting manually under Options->Controller Setup->Redefine Controls like I have written in the following list. Before entering the assignments delete every entry by using Backspace while holding the mouse cursor over an entry.
I recommend to copy&paste this list into notepad and to print from there, that way it fits on only one sheet.

You also need to select under "Options->Controller Setup" "Configuration: Mouse+Keys" otherwise the right stick wont work, and in the Mouse  Settings "Steer with mouse:off" and "Fly with mouse: off".

Profile:
On button "A" Jump is assigned on tap and Sprint on hold.
On a bicycle you can tap A to cycle faster and hold A to use the rear brakes.
Drive-by-shooting: Hold the right stick button and move the stick to the left/right to look there and press the left Stick Button to shoot.
Zoom in/out with Sniper Rifle: hold right stick button+right stick up/down.
Hydra engine control: left shoulder button for up and left shoulder button while holding the right stick button for down (not perfect, but I couldn't find a better solution).

One problem stays, the character still moves with the Dpad too. But the Dpad is required, so it has these double assignments.

Here is the finished list with the controls, note that you need to download the new profile for the Legend function of the map.

Code: Select all

FOOT CONTROLS
Left stick: Movement
Left stick button: Crouch

Right stick: Look, Aim
Right stick button: Look Back
Right stick up/down+Right Stick Button=Zoom In/Out with Sniper Rifle

DPad up/down: Gang Control Forward/Backward
Dpad left/right: No/Yes

A (tapping): Sprint
A (hold): Jump
B: show Action Panel
Y: Enter/Exit Vehicle

Start: Pause
Back: Change Camera

Right trigger: Fire
Left trigger: Aim

RB: Next Weapon/Target
LB: Previous Weapon/Target

VEHICLE CONTROLS
Left stick left/right: Steer Left/Right, Roll on air vehicles
Left stick up/down: Lean Forward/Backward, Pitch on air vehicles
Left stick button: Horn

Right stick: Move Camera
Right stick left/right+right stick button: Look Left/Right Yaw on air vehicles
Right stick left/right+right stick button: Drive-By-Shooting
Right stick up+right stick button: look back


Dpad up: Sub-Mission, retract landing gear on airplanes
Dpad down: User Track Skip
Dpad left/right: Select Radio Station

A (taping): drive faster with bicycle
A (hold): Handbrake
Y: Enter/Exit Vehicle
X (or right+left stick button): Fire

Start: Pause
Back: Change Camera

Right trigger: Accelerate
Left trigger: Brake/Reverse

LB: Hydra thruster up
LB+right stick button: Hydra thrusters down

MAP

Left stick: Scroll

Right stick: move cursor
Right stick up/down+right stick button: Zoom

X:Legend (needs new profile)

Right trigger: Set Target

MENU
Left stick or Dpad: up/down

Right Stick: move cursor

A: Select
Y, Start: Back

Right trigger: click
